psychotomimetic
psychotomimetic definition - medical
psy·chot·o·mi·met·ic (sī-kŏtˌō-mə-mĕtˈĭk, -mī-)
adjective Tending to induce hallucinations, delusions, or other symptoms of a psychosis. Used of a drug.
noun A psychotomimetic drug, such as LSD.
